What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Almont, North Dakota?
In Almont, ND,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,000, depending on the level of care, room type, and amenities. This is generally lower than the national average and reflects North Dakota's overall cost of living. Specific facilities in or near Almont may offer different pricing structures, so it's advisable to contact them directly for detailed quotes.
Are there any assisted living facilities directly in Almont, or will we need to look in nearby cities?
Almont is a small community, so dedicated assisted living facilities within the city limits are limited. Families often look to nearby larger cities such as Bismarck or Mandan, which are within a reasonable driving distance and offer multiple options. Some residential care homes or smaller senior housing setups might be available locally, but for comprehensive assisted living services, expanding your search to the Bismarck-Mandan area is common for Almont residents.

How are assisted living facilities regulated in North Dakota, and what should we look for to ensure quality?
In North Dakota,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the North Dakota Department of Health and Human Services (HHS). They must comply with state rules regarding staffing, safety, and care standards. When evaluating options near Almont, look for facilities with up-to-date licenses, good inspection records, and positive reviews from families. You can verify a facility's compliance status through the ND HHS website or by asking the facility directly for their licensing information.
Are there local resources in Almont or Morton County to help seniors transition to assisted living?
Yes, there are resources available. The Morton County Senior Services and the Aging and Disability Resource Link (ADRL) through the North Dakota Department of Human Services can provide guidance on assisted living options, financial assistance programs, and care coordination. While Almont itself may have limited on-site agencies, these county and state resources offer support to residents in rural areas, helping with assessments, applications, and connecting families to appropriate facilities in the region.
